Transaction 21dbbee7f8b357676c394298cf2dc6fe830cebe76c4e4275009dd2566f35ab07

1 Input
2 Outputs
  • 21dbbee7f8b357676c394298cf2dc6fe830cebe76c4e4275009dd2566f35ab07:0
  • value  2164799
    address  17aMADZST1CFvZRbLdXknozQZGduLHjktA
  • 21dbbee7f8b357676c394298cf2dc6fe830cebe76c4e4275009dd2566f35ab07:1
  • value  35929762
    address  1Q7vXZc6mF7pkdtWiqqYv31bE7wzMDtfNm